What’s Actually In Mushroom Coffee?

Functional mushroom ingredients like:

  • Lion’s Mane for focus & mental clarity
  • Reishi for calm & stress support
  • Chaga & Cordyceps for energy & immunity

Why This Trend Is Blowing Up Right Now

This is the bigger story.

We are in the middle of a “coffee that does more” revolution.

People don’t just want caffeine anymore.

They want:

  • Focus without jitters
  • Energy without crashes
  • Daily habits that double as wellness tools

And yes… even decaf that actually gives you energy.

It’s a mindset shift.

Where This Is Going

Mushroom coffee is still a small slice of the overall coffee market, but it’s pointing to something much bigger:

  The rise of functional everything
  The merging of wellness and convenience
  And consumers demanding more from everyday products
